$Projectname can be configured in many different ways. One of the configurations available at installation is to select a 'server role'. There are currently three server roles. We highly recommend that you use 'standard' unless you have special needs.
#### Basic
The 'basic' server role is designed to be relatively simple, and it doesn't present options
or complicated features. The hub admin may configure additional features at a site level.
This role is designed for simple social networking and social network federation. Many features
which do not federate easily have been removed, including (and this is somewhat important)
"nomadic identity". You may move a channel to or from a basic server, but you may not clone
it. Once moved, it becomes read-only on the origination site. No updates of any kind will be
provided. It is recommended that after the move, the original channel be deleted - as it is
no longer useable. The data remains only in case there are issues making a copy of the data.
This role is supported by the hubzilla community.
#### Standard
The 'standard' server role is recommended for most sites. All features of the software are
available to everybody unless locked by the hub administrator. Some features will not federate
easily with other networks, so there is often an increased support burden explaining why
sharing events with Diaspora (for instance) presents a different experience on that network.
Additionally any member can enable "advanced" or "expert" features, and these may be beyond
their technical skill level. This may also result in an increased support burden.
This role is supported by the hubzilla community.
#### Pro
The 'pro' server role is primarily designed for communities which want to present a uniform
experience and be relieved of many federation support issues. In this role there is
**no federation with other networks**. Additional features **may** be provided, such
as channel ratings, premium channels, and e-commerce.
By default a channel may set a "techlevel" appropriate to their technical skill. Higher
levels provide more features. Everybody starts with techlevel 0 (similar to the 'basic'
role) where all complicated features are hidden from view. Increasing the techlevel provides
more advanced or complex features.
The hub admin may also lock individual channels or their entire site at a defined techlevel
which provides an installation with a selection of advanced features consistent with the
perceived technical skills of the members. For instance, a community for horse racing might
have a different techlevel than a community for Linux kernel developers.
This role is not supported by the hubzilla community.
Techlevels is a unique feature of Hubzilla 'pro'. It is not available in other server_roles, although it expands on the concepts introduced in $Projectname 'basic'.
We've implemented several different mechanisms in order to reduce the apparent complexity and learning curve presented to new members. At the same time, we do not wish to limit any functionality for people who are able to grasp some slightly advanced technical technical features. The first mechanism was to move several features to an optional 'Features' page where they could be enabled at will; with the default interface kept somewhat lean.
The problem we had now is that the number of features began to grow dramatically, and the Feature page is daunting in possibilities. There are also features present which probably should not be available to all members, but may be extremely useful to those with technical backgrounds.
The techlevels seeeks to remedy this by grouping features within different levels of technical ability; starting at 0 (uncomfortable with technology), and up to 5 (Unix wizard or equivalent).
When a new member registers, their account is provided a techlevel setting of 0. On the account settings page they may change this to any available level. A higher level opens more advanced features and possible interactions.
The account administrator may also lock a particular level, lock a maximum level, or change/re-arrange the features available to any level. Those with the minimum level are typically not very exploratory and are unlikely to discover the advanced modes. This is by design. Those that look around and desire more interactions will find them. In the absence of administrator defaults they may choose any level. As they look at the features available to the level in question, it is generally expected that they will discover some features are beyond their comprehension and it is hoped they will back off to a level where the interface and features are comfortable to their skill level. This is somewhat experimental at present and for that reason is not part of the 'standard' server role. The standard server role is preset to level '5', and the basic server role is preset to level '0', with no possibility of change. Members in these roles may find themselves overwhelmed or underwhelmed by the feature set and complexity.
Service classes allow you to set limits on system resources by limiting what individual
accounts can do, including file storage and top-level post limits. Define custom service
classes according to your needs in the `.htconfig.php` file. For example, create
a _standard_ and _premium_ class using the following lines:
// Service classes
App::$config['system']['default_service_class']='standard'; // this is the default service class that is attached to every new account
// configuration for parent service class
App::$config['service_class']['standard'] =
array('photo_upload_limit'=>2097152, // total photo storage limit per channel (here 2MB)
'total_identities' =>1, // number of channels an account can create
'total_items' =>0, // number of top level posts a channel can create. Applies only to top level posts of the channel user, other posts and comments are unaffected
'total_pages' =>100, // number of pages a channel can create
'total_channels' =>100, // number of channels the user can add, other users can still add this channel, even if the limit is reached
'attach_upload_limit' =>2097152, // total attachment storage limit per channel (here 2MB)
'chatters_inroom' =>20);
// configuration for teacher service class
App::$config['service_class']['premium'] =
array('photo_upload_limit'=>20000000000, // total photo storage limit per channel (here 20GB)
'total_identities' =>20, // number of channels an account can create
'total_items' =>20000, // number of top level posts a channel can create. Applies only to top level posts of the channel user, other posts and comments are unaffected
'total_pages' =>400, // number of pages a channel can create
'total_channels' =>2000, // number of channels the user can add, other users can still add this channel, even if the limit is reached
'attach_upload_limit' =>20000000000, // total attachment storage limit per channel (here 20GB)
'chatters_inroom' =>100);
To apply a service class to an existing account, use the command line utility from the
web root:
`util/service_class`
list service classes
`util/config system default_service_class firstclass`
set the default service class to 'firstclass'
`util/service_class firstclass`
list the services that are part of 'firstclass' service class

The system logfile is an extremely useful resource for tracking down things that go wrong. This can be enabled in the admin/log configuration page. A loglevel setting of LOGGER_DEBUG is preferred for stable production sites. Most things that go wrong with communications or storage are listed here. A setting of LOGGER_DATA provides [b]much[/b] more detail, but may fill your disk. In either case we recommend the use of logrotate on your operating system to cycle logs and discard older entries.
At the bottom of your .htconfig.php file are several lines (commented out) which enable PHP error logging. This reports issues with code syntax and executing the code and is the first place you should look for issues which result in a "white screen" or blank page. This is typically the result of code/syntax problems.
Database errors are reported to the system logfile, but we've found it useful to have a file in your top-level directory called dbfail.out which [b]only[/b] collects database related issues. If the file exists and is writable, database errors will be logged to it as well as to the system logfile.
In the case of "500" errors, the issues may often be logged in your webserver logs, often /var/log/apache2/error.log or something similar. Consult your operating system documentation.
**The first is the database failure log**. This is only used if you create a file called specifically 'dbfail.out' in the root folder of your website and make it write-able by the web server. If we have any database failed queries, they are all reported here. They generally indicate typos in our queries, but also occur if the database server disconnects or tables get corrupted. On rare occasions we'll see race conditions in here where two processes tried to create an xchan or cache entry with the same ID. Any other errors (especially persistent errors) should be investigated.
**The second is the PHP error log**. This is created by the language processor and only reports issues in the language environment. Again these can be syntax errors or programming errors, but these generally are fatal and result in a "white screen of death"; e.g. PHP terminates. You should probably look at this file if something goes wrong that doesn't result in a white screen of death, but it isn't uncommon for this file to be empty for days on end.
There are some lines at the bottom of the supplied .htconfig.php file; which if uncommented will enable a PHP error log (*extremely* useful for finding the source of white screen failures). This isn't done by default due to potential issues with logfile ownership and write permissions and the fact that there is no logfile rotation by default.
**The third is the "application log"**. This is used by $Projectname to report what is going on in the program and usually reports any difficulties or unexpected data we received. It also occasionally reports "heartbeat" status messages to indicate that we reached a certain point in a script. **This** is the most important log file to us, as we create it ourself for the sole purpose of reporting the status of background tasks and anything that seems weird or out of place. It may not be fatal, but maybe just unexpected. If you're performing a task and there's a problem, let us know what is in this file when the problem occurred. (Please don't send me 100M dumps you'll only piss me off). Just a few relevant lines so I can rule out a few hundred thousand lines of code and concentrate on where the problem starts showing up.
These are your site logs, not mine. We report serious issues at any log level. I highly recommend 'DEBUG' log level for most sites - which provides a bit of additional info and doesn't create huge logfiles. When there's a problem which defies all attempts to track, you might wish to use DATA log level for a short period of time to capture all the detail of what structures we were dealing with at the time. This log level will use a lot of space so is recommended only for brief periods or for developer test sites.
I recommend configuring logrotate for both the php log and the application log. I usually have a look at dbfail.out every week or two, fix any issues reported and then starting over with a fresh file. Likewise with the PHP logfile. I refer to it once in a while to see if there's something that needs fixing.
If something goes wrong, and it's not a fatal error, I look at the application logfile. Often I will
```
tail -f logfile.out
```
While repeating an operation that has problems. Often I'll insert extra logging statements in the code if there isn't any hint what's going wrong. Even something as simple as "got here" or printing out the value of a variable that might be suspect. You can do this too - in fact I encourage you to do so. Once you've found what you need to find, you can
```
git checkout file.php
```
To immediately clear out all the extra logging stuff you added. Use the information from this log and any detail you can provide from your investigation of the problem to file your bug report - unless your analysis points to the source of the problem. In that case, just fix it.
When reporting issues, please try to provide as much detail as may be necessary for developers to reproduce the issue and provide the complete text of all error messages.
We encourage you to try to the best of your abilities to use these logs combined with the source code in your possession to troubleshoot issues and find their cause. The community is often able to help, but only you have access to your site logfiles and it is considered a security risk to share them.
If a code issue has been uncovered, please report it on the project bugtracker (https://github.com/redmatrix/hubzilla/issues). Again provide as much detail as possible to avoid us going back and forth asking questions about your configuration or how to duplicate the problem, so that we can get right to the problem and figure out what to do about it. You are also welcome to offer your own solutions and submit patches. In fact we encourage this as we are all volunteers and have little spare time available. The more people that help, the easier the workload for everybody. It's OK if your solution isn't perfect. Every little bit helps and perhaps we can improve on it.
